Abstract

The invention relates to a pneumatic tire for an automobile having tread lug rows, each being interspaced in an axial direction by a peripheral groove, and wherein at least one tread lug row (2, 3) is configured to include a transverse groove (13, 14) of interspaced tread lug elements (9, 10). In each transverse groove (13, 14) of the tread lug row (2, 3), in the respective two axial outer border areas of the transverse groove (13, 14) within the footprint width TA, a connecting piece (16, 17) elevated from the groove bottom of the transverse groove (13, 14) is formed extending in a peripheral direction U, and interconnecting the two tread lug elements (9, 10) interspaced by the transverse groove.

Description

technical field

[0001] The invention relates to a vehicle pneumatic tire, in particular for passenger cars, having a tread pattern with radially raised tread bands extending over the circumference of said vehicle pneumatic tire (e.g. rows of shaped blocks or circumferential ribs), the tread bands are respectively separated from each other in the axial direction by a circumferential groove extending on the circumference of the vehicle pneumatic tire, where in the axial direction A At least one column of shaped blocks having a width b measured inside the ground-bearing width is composed of a plurality of shaped blocks arranged successively in the circumferential direction U of the vehicle pneumatic tire and correspondingly separated from each other by a transverse groove Composition of block elements.
